1. Engineering & Technical Leadership
  • Lead the delivery of engineering activities relating to the marine interface within the MBIF scope.
  • Ensure all works comply with technical specifications, design drawings, ITPs, and regulatory requirements.
  • Provide expert technical input on matters involving coastal processes, tidal influences, material deposition, and interface with marine infrastructure.
  • Support preparation and review of method statements, RAMS, temporary works designs, and marine-related sequencing.
  • Lead coordination of surveys (bathymetric, topographic, monitoring of shoreline changes).
2. Marine Interface Management
  • Act as the engineering focal point between the Enabling & Earthworks team and marine contractors, marine logistics, harbour authorities, and coastal engineering consultants.
  • Coordinate material movements involving barges, landing areas, marine unloading zones, and near shore staging points.
  • Ensure compliance with marine safety regulations, vessel movement protocols, and environmental constraints.
  • Monitor tidal windows, weather conditions, and marine access constraints that impact MBIF delivery.
3. Quality Assurance & Compliance
  • Oversee testing and inspection regimes for marine-related fill operations, including placement, compaction, and acceptance criteria.
  • Manage NCRs, technical queries, design change requests, and ensure timely close‑out.
  • Maintain engineering records, as‑built documentation, and quality packs.
  • Ensure compliance with nuclear‑regulated documentation standards and traceability requirements.
4. Planning & Coordination
  • Work with the Project Manager and Works Manager to plan marine‑interface activities, resource requirements, and look‑ahead schedules.
  • Review progress against programme and identify risks, constraints, and opportunities for improved sequencing.li>
  • Ensure engineering readiness for key MBIF marine milestones.
  • Coordinate geotechnical data, survey results, and marine monitoring information to support design validation.
  • Embed a high safety culture, aligned with Sizewell C nuclear standards and marine safety regulations.
  • Ensure marine‑specific hazards‑tidal conditions, vessel movements, working near water‑are controlled and actively managed.
  • Support environmental compliance, including coastal protection measures, sediment control, marine fauna restrictions, and environmental monitoring.
  • Participate in incident investigations and support corrective action plans.
  • Provide mentoring and technical guidance to site engineers, graduate engineers, and supervisors.
  • Support competency development within the engineering team, especially regarding marine operations and earthworks integration.
  • Facilitate effective communication and coordination between operational teams, survey, logistics, and subcontractors.
Requirements
  • SMSTS or SSSTS certification.
  • Chartered or working toward chartership (ICE, IMarEST, CIWEM).
  • Degree or equivalent in Civil Engineering, Marine Engineering, or Coastal Engineering.
  • Experience on nuclear‑regulated or high‑compliance infrastructure projects.
  • Experience with large‑scale material movements involving marine logistics (barges, landing craft, etc.).
  • Strong experience as a Senior Engineer or Section Engineer on major civil engineering or marine infrastructure projects.
  • Technical knowledge of marine construction or coastal engineering.
  • Understanding of UK coastal regulations, CDM requirements, and site safety standards.
  • Excellent communication and coordination skills, especially with multidisciplinary teams.
